Students can choose up to three courses: a morning session and an afternoon session, and an evening session.
Class time: Morning Session (09:00~11:45) / Afternoon Session (13:00~15:45) / Evening Session (16:00~18:45) Monday to Friday (5 days a week)
Each ISS course, which provides 3 academic credits, requires students to fulfill 3 study hours per day throughout the whole program, while Korean language courses worth 2 academic credits require to fulfill 2 study hours per day.
Courses are subject to change or may be cancelled, depending on the status of registration.
